BATON ROUGE – Katrina Hegge, a two-time All-West Coach Conference first-team golf selection , will transfer from the University of San Francisco to begin playing this fall with the nationally-ranked LSU women’s golf team.

Coach Karen Bahnsen announced the transfer after the compliance office at LSU received and approved Southeastern Conference signee papers.

Hegge, who played for the Dons the past two years, will be eligible immediately under NCAA transfer rules for the sport of women’s golf.

A native of Seattle, averaged 76.73 as a freshman and 76.77 as a sophomore with seven top 10 finishes in her first two years at San Francisco and three top fives including a victory in the Fresno Lexus Classic when she posted a 54-hole score of 216 (73-72-71). She has finished in the top 10 in both WCC championship events she has played in, finishing eighth as a freshman and seven in her sophomore season.

“We are excited to have Katrina join our program here at LSU,” said Bahnsen, whose Lady Tigers posted their highest NCAA Division I Women’s Championship finish of third last month.  “She is going to be a great addition to a program that has shown it can contend for a national championship.”

Prior to attending San Francisco, Hegge won two Washington high school state championships in 2009 and 2006. She shot a course record 67 in the opening round of the 2009 event.  She was named two-time Washington Junior Golf Association Player of the Year. She was runnerup in the 2008 Arizona Silver Belle tournament at the Arizona State Karsten Golf Course, shooting a three-under 213, one stroke behind the eventual medalist.

She has ranked in the national statistics, finishing in the top 50 nationally in among Division I women’s college golfers in par-3 greens in regulation at 68.3 percent and No. 64 in the country in birdies with 54.

Hegge joins fall signee Madelene Sagstrom of Sweden on the roster for the 2011-12 LSU Women’s Golf season.
